Virginia Held explores how feminist theory is changing contemporary views of moral choice. She proposes a comprehensive philosophy of feminist ethics, arguing for reconceptualizations of the self; of relations between the self and others; and of images of birth and death, nurturing and violence. Held shows how social, political and cultural institutions have traditionally been founded upon masculine ideals of morality. She then identifies a distinct feminist morality that moves beyond culturally embedded notions about motherhood and female emotionality, and she discusses its far-reaching implications for altering many contemporary social problems, including standards of freedom, democracy, equality, and personal development.","brand":"The University of Chicago Press","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":54218445521240,"sku":"9780226325910","price":92.99,"currency_code":"EUR","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0278\/1295\/4195\/files\/9780226325910.jpg?v=1769750125","url":"https:\/\/agendabookshop.com\/products\/feminist-morality-1","provider":"Agenda Bookshop","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
